WebbThere are three theories of commodity futures returns: Insurance theory: Commodity producers sell the commodity in futures market in order to make their revenues predictable. This implies that the futures price must be less than the spot price as a payment to the speculator for providing insurance to the producer. WebbThe theory of increasing returns is new, but it already is well established. And it renders such markets amenable to economic understanding. In 1939, ... WebbInsurance theory. The insurance theory of futures returns was proposed by John Maynard Keynes. The theory argues that producers of commodities wish to reduce their price risk by selling futures contracts. Thus, producers want to purchase insurance. This selling drives down the futures price and should lead to a backwardation of the futures curve.
